yeah, the bullitt , cobra and mach 1 all use the 13" fronts and ~12" rears.
I got the bullitt ones because i didnt want them to say cobra, the mach ones are plain with no logo. and the rear calipers are the same on any new edge, except some minor differences in the caliper bracket, the cobra. mach/ bullitt just use different brackets for the rear end, pads and rotors in the rear. |
